Tapbit constantly disallows traders from withdrawing their hard-earned funds. The broker gives numerous reasons to block their withdrawal access, and many of them sound illegitimate as per traders. Here are some withdrawal-related complaints that drew our attention.

Trading rules change with the blink of an eye at Tapbit. The broker introduces new rules suddenly to surprise you. In one such case, a trader seeking withdrawals worth $30,000 was asked to prepay $3000. Further, the trader was asked to pay the conversion fee worth $10,000. The trader, understandably, could not pay all that, leading to withdrawal blocks.

The growing trader complaints made the WikiFX team investigate Tapbit on various aspects. After analyzing the broker carefully, the team found it to be unlicensed, adding credence to the red flags raised by traders. In view of the growing investment risks for traders, the WikiFX team gave Tapbit a poor score of 1.39 out of 10.
